Yankees Considering Starts For Ben Rice At Catcher
www.mlbtraderumors.com

The New York Yankees are gearing up for the return of Giancarlo Stanton, a move that could significantly boost their offense. However, this comeback poses a challenge: how to allocate playing time for breakout designated hitter Ben Rice. As Stanton prepares to reclaim his spot, the Yankees must navigate a crowded lineup, especially with Paul Goldschmidt firmly at first base.

Rice, 26, has impressed this season, boasting a .240/.326/.495 slash line and a wRC+ of 130 over 57 games. His productivity is crucial, yet with Stanton’s return, he may find it tough to maintain consistent playing time. Reports suggest that Yankees manager Aaron Boone is considering giving Rice some starts behind the plate, despite him not catching this season. This unexpected opportunity could be pivotal for Rice, especially as the Yankees look to maximize their offensive potential.
